Loud noise, a dark small car and an arrest: the police were on duty at Buckingham Palace.

A car crashed into a gate at Buckingham Palace on Sunday night London crashed. The Metropolitan Police announced this at the request of the German Press Agency. A man was arrested on suspicion of criminal damage. He was taken to a hospital, it said. There were no reports of injuries.

The Mirror newspaper had a shaky video on its website that appears to show the moment of the arrest. It shows a person kneeling in front of Buckingham Palace with his hands behind his neck and being surrounded by others. A dark small car sits between the posts of one of the gates to the palace with its hazard lights on. The brief report on the “Mirror” website also said that an eyewitness became aware of what was happening because of a loud noise.

Nothing was initially known about the background to the incident, which is said to have occurred around 2:30 a.m. (local time). According to the police, this is now the subject of the investigation.
